Olympus Force: The Key
Action
2.5
Olympian gods watch the Earth and resolve to fight a group of terrorists who stole a diskette containing a secret that can destroy the world.
© 2025 AniVerse Pte Ltd
EnjoyTown doesn't store any media listed; we only link to third-party sources.